Yaris does all things very well for very little $$$

hkyang, 03/23/2011
2010 Toyota Yaris 4dr Sedan (1.5L 4cyl 4A)
18 of 20 people found this review helpful

COMFORT: The sedan has longest wheelbase in its EPA class, allowing it THE most rearseat legroom in its class. Check specs! This makes more than comfortable road trips with family or friends. CONVENIENCE: Yaris sedan trunk BIGGER THAN COROLLA's! Check specs! Much is made of Honda FIT's cargo space, but on vacation with your family of four, FIT is reduced to being just another hatchback: LESS trunk space than a sedan, unless you WANT to cram the back so full you can't see out the rear! PERFORMANCE: Only thing that beats YarisSEDAN's turning circle is a Yaris 3-dr HATCH. Only thing that beats Yaris MPG is the all-new, Made in Mexico, Fix Or Repair Daily Focus. Yaris is tried 'n true.

Great Economy Car for Hard Times

boydoo, 11/22/2009
2010 Toyota Yaris 4dr Sedan (1.5L 4cyl 4A)
7 of 7 people found this review helpful

This Car has everything we wanted. Reasonable price, and great gas mileage for a non Hybrid. It is a solid, well built car with Toyota reliability. My wife being short, loves the tall driving position as she can finally see the road. We adapted quickly to the center mounted gauges. Not an issue for us. I have to laugh at most of the professional reviews I have read. They live in different world than people who want cars in this segment. They test like we have the peddle to the metal from every stop light. The car has plenty of power for everyday commuting. And the ride is good, and the car runs very smoothly. Even with the Power Package this car seems simple. We love this car.
